High School Engagement Teacher in 2010. Role involved teaching Aboriginal students unable to learn in mainstream classes. Year 5 Classroom Teacher in 2011. While at university I was offered a paid scholarship to finish my studies and then travel to a remote part of Western Australia to work at a hard to staff school. During my time there I took part in many community projects aimed at getting local children excited to come to school. While there, attendance rates rose from 55% to over 80%. I was also in charge of overseeing the installation of the school's first Smartboards, then running Professional Development sessions to train the staff in their use. Show less
